About This Item

New York: New American Library, 1951 A basic guide to American antiques from 1600 to 1900. 192 pages including index. The backstrip is creased. The covers are rubbed. The edges are moderately worn. A price is written in ink on the FFEP. The text is age-toned on the edges but clean.
